Levels

The level description is also used as the manifest text, which is displayed as part of the title of many options when you Assemble a Skeleton. The level depends on which item you used as the basis for your skeleton.

0: Hypothetical
10: Human (from Headless Skeleton)
15: Human (from Human Ribcage)
20: Thorny-Breasted (from Thorned Ribcage)
30: Seven-necked (from Skeleton with Seven Necks)
40: Many-limbed (from Flourishing Ribcage)
45: Segmented (from Segmented Ribcage)
50: Mammoth (from Mammoth Ribcage)
55: Luminous (from Glim-Encrusted Carapace)
60: Baroque (from Ribcage with a Bouquet of Eight Spines)
70: Deep-water (from Leviathan Frame)
80: Prismatic (from Prismatic Frame)
100: Starved (from Five-Pointed Ribcage)
